Platform Caught Overhead
If the platform becomes jammed or snagged in overhead
structures or equipment, do not continue operation of the
machine from either the platform or the ground until the
operator and all personnel are safely moved to a secure
location. Only then should an attempt be made to free the
platform using any necessary equipment and personnel.
Do not remove outriggers or attempt to move machine
unless a crane, forklift or other suitable equipment is avail-
able to safely lower machine to ground.
Righting of Tipped Machine
Before righting a tipped machine, check machine for any
damage which may prevent it from setting properly on its
base wheels once in a vertical position, (i.e. base wheels
damaged, base frame distorted, etc.). Use a crane, forklift
or other suitable lifting equipment and carefully lift the
machine to an upright postion.
Post-Incident Inspection
Following any incident, thoroughly inspect the machine
and test all functions. Do not lift platform above 10 feet (3
meters) until you are sure that all damage has been
repaired and that all controls and machine components
are operating correctly.

INCIDENT NOTIFICATION
It is imperative that JLG Industries, Inc. be notified imme-
diately of any incident involving a JLG product. Even if no
injury or property damage is evident, the Product Safety
and Reliability Department at the factory should be con-
tacted by telephone and provided with all necessary
details.

It should be noted that failure to notify the Manufacturer of
an incident involving a JLG Industries product within 48
hours of such an occurrence may void any warranty con-
sideration on that particular machine.
